Key Responsibilities of a Sales VA in Event-Based Businesses

So, we’ve established that your sales team is likely buried under a mountain of logistics.

You know you need help, but what exactly does that help look like day-to-day? It’s easy to think of a Virtual Assistant (VA) as someone who just "answers emails," but for event businesses, a specialized Sales VA is a powerhouse of productivity.

Let’s break down the specific responsibilities a Sales VA takes on to transform your chaotic scramble into a well-oiled machine. It’s about more than just support; it’s about giving your sales process a spine.

1. Managing Leads and Follow-Ups

This is the big one. How many times have you met a promising prospect at a mixer, only to lose their business card or forget to email them until three weeks later? A Sales VA ensures that never happens. They take raw leads: whether from web forms, conference scanners, or business cards: and immediately enter them into your system.

But they don't stop there. They initiate the follow-up sequences. While you are out pitching to a major sponsor, your VA is sending personalized follow-up emails to the ten people you met yesterday, keeping those leads warm and moving them down the funnel.

2. Pipeline Updates and Coordination

A stagnant pipeline is a dead pipeline. Your VA is responsible for the hygiene of your sales process. Did a prospect ask for a quote? Your VA updates the deal stage. Did a meeting get cancelled? They move the contact back to "nurture."

They also act as the bridge between sales and operations. If you close a sponsorship deal, the VA ensures the operations team knows exactly what deliverables are needed: logos, banners, booth specs: without you having to sit in a handover meeting every single time.

3. Proposal and Material Prep

Imagine heading into a pitch meeting with a presentation that is already formatted, proofread, and customized for the client. That is the reality with a Sales VA. You provide the raw data and strategy; they handle the assembly. They can draft proposals based on templates, gather case studies, and ensure your pitch deck looks professional, saving you hours of formatting hell.

Administrative Assistance Backbone of Operations

While "admin" might sound boring, in the event world, it is critical. These are the tasks that, if neglected, cause the wheels to fall off.

1. Scheduling and Calendar Tetris

Coordinating a call between a busy sales manager, a venue coordinator, and a client in a different time zone is a nightmare. A Sales VA handles this entirely. They communicate with all parties, find a slot that works, send the invites, and confirm attendance. All you have to do is show up.

2. CRM Accuracy (The Holy Grail)

We’ve all heard the saying, "If it isn't in Salesforce/HubSpot, it didn't happen." But let's be honest, high-performing salespeople are notoriously bad at data entry. A Sales VA lives in your CRM. They ensure every interaction is logged, every contact detail is correct, and every note is searchable. This means your reports are accurate, and you actually know what is going on in your business.

3. Tracking Metrics and KPIs

You can’t improve what you don’t measure. A Sales VA tracks the numbers that matter. They can compile weekly reports on how many calls were made, how many proposals were sent, and what the conversion rate looks like for the upcoming expo. Instead of you spending your Friday afternoon crunching numbers in Excel, you get a clean report delivered to your inbox, ready for your Monday strategy meeting.
